Math

  • The child practiced counting and sorting the different Lego pieces.
  • They learned about shapes and patterns by building structures using Lego bricks.
  • The child gained understanding of spatial relationships and measurements while following instructions to build specific Lego models.
  • They enhanced their problem-solving skills by figuring out how many bricks are needed to complete a design.

Continue to develop the child's math skills by encouraging them to create their own Lego designs and challenging them to calculate the total number of bricks required. You can also introduce concepts like area and perimeter by asking them to measure the dimensions of their Lego creations using a ruler.
